@treatmyocd: 5 unexpected ways OCD can look a lot like depression: 1️⃣ You stop doing things you normally enjoy: OCD can make certain hobbies, places, or activities feel too triggering. Avoiding them can temporarily reduce the anxiety, but over time, you may find yourself doing less and less of what you enjoy. 2️⃣ You feel exhausted all the time: Mental compulsions can take up hours without anyone else realizing it. Replaying conversations, reviewing memories, analyzing thoughts, or checking how you feel over and over can be incredibly draining. 3️⃣ You isolate yourself from other people: If certain people or social situations trigger your OCD, avoiding them can feel like the easiest way to get relief. Over time, that can look a lot like withdrawing or losing interest in being around others. 4️⃣ You have a hard time getting things done: OCD can turn simple tasks into long processes of checking, rereading, restarting, repeating, or trying to get something “just right.” You may look unmotivated when you’re actually stuck in a cycle of compulsions. 5️⃣ You spend more time in bed or doing nothing: When almost anything could bring up an intrusive thought or trigger the urge to do a compulsion, avoiding your day altogether can start to feel easier. From the outside, that can look a lot like depression. OCD and depression can also happen at the same time. The important distinction here is what’s driving the behavior.
